Wingman Zhang flies through China's Tianmen Cave

STORY: Wingman Zhang flies through China's Tianmen Cave DATELINE: May 1, 2023 LENGTH: 00:00:40 LOCATION: ZHANGJIAJIE, China CATEGORY: SOCIETY SHOTLIST: 1. various of Zhang Shupeng flying through Tianmen Cave STORYLINE: Zhang Shupeng, the daring Chinese wingsuiter, has successfully flown through China's famed Tianmen Cave on Sunday in Zhangjiajie, central China's Hunan Province. Zhang took a helicopter to a height of nearly 2,200 meters behind Tianmen Cave. He jumped out of the cabin wearing a wingsuit and successfully flew through Tianmen Cave at a speed of 180 km/h. When Zhang accomplished the feat, everyone in the crowd cheered and clapped loudly, praising how impressive the flight was. Then, Zhang continued to glide and successfully completed the challenge by landing effortlessly at the designated landing point. Tanaka wins 1st UHB Cup

SAPPORO, Japan - Photo shows Shota Tanaka's first jump at the UHB Cup at the Okurayama K-120 large hill in Sapporo on Jan. 6, 2013. Tanaka moved into second with a leap of 131.5 meters on his first attempt and sealed victory with a second jump of 125 meters. He had a winning total of 257.7 points.

Pettersen wins his second title in World Cup ski jumping

SAPPORO, Japan - Sigurd Pettersen of Norway sails through the air to mark longest jump of 131.5 meters in the second round at the K-120 Okurayama hill in Sapporo on Jan. 26, claiming his second World Cup ski jumping title of the season.
